Output 80f263e54670b4d7984a27c618d1bfd7ce49e78420d7ec7f75da6a5eb86aeb27:3

value
381938861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c6901557839d5ee5eaac66d824c22c90370164 OP_EQUAL
address
3NN6WHT3kzj7Jh7bYoESzKeTBTN4Bi6s3t
transaction
80f263e54670b4d7984a27c618d1bfd7ce49e78420d7ec7f75da6a5eb86aeb27
confirmations
335761
spent
true